TIM ROSEBROUGH COMMITS TO PLAY SOCCER AT UNION

Jackson, TN--The 91±¬ÁÏÍø men's soccer team added another player to their roster for the 1998 season when Tim Rosebrough committed to play for the Bulldogs. Rosebrough is a 1998 graduate of Gateway Baptist School in Memphis. Rosebrough played two seasons at Heritage Christian School and North Side High School here in Jackson. While at Heritage Christian Rosebrough earned the Best Offensive Award in both his freshman and sophomore seasons. He also earned all-district honors and was chosen for the All-Star Game as a sophomore. During his sophomore season Rosebrough scored eight goals and had 11 assists. His junior seasons he scored seven goals with 11 assists.

Tim is the son of Dr. Tom Rosebrough who is presently the Dean of the School of Education and Human Studies and a Professor of Education at 91±¬ÁÏÍø.
